2sd669/a npn silicon transistor unisonic technologies co., ltd 3 of 5 www.unisonic.com.tw qw-r204-005,f ? absolute maximum rating ( ta= 25 , unless otherwise specified) parameter symbol ratings unit collector-base voltage v cbo 180 v 2sd669 120 collector-emitter voltage 2sd669a v ceo 160 v emitter-base voltage v ebo 5 v collector current i c 1.5 a collector peak current l c(peak) 3 a collector power dissipation sot-223 0.5 w collector power dissipation to-126 p d 1 w junction temperature t j +150 storage temperature t stg -40 ~ +150 note: absolute maximum ratings are those values beyond which the device could be permanently damaged. absolute maximum ratings are stress ratings only and functional device oper ation is not implied. ? electrical characteristics (ta=25 , unless otherwise specified) parameter symbol test conditions min typ max unit collector to base breakdown voltage bv cbo i c =1ma, i e =0 180 v 2sd669 120 collector to emitter breakdown voltage 2sd669a bv ceo i c =10ma, r be = 160 v emitter to base breakdown voltage bv ebo i e =1ma, i c =0 5 v collector cut-off current i cbo v cb =160v, i e =0 10 a h fe1 v ce =5v, i c =150ma (note) 60 320 dc current gain h fe2 v ce =5v, i c =500ma (note) 30 collector-emitter satu ration voltage v ce(sat) i c =600ma, i b =50ma (note) 1 v base-emitter voltage v be v ce =5v, i c =150ma (note) 1.5 v current gain bandwidth product f t v ce =5v, i c =150ma (note) 140 mhz output capacitance c ob v cb =10v, i e =0, f=1mhz 14 pf note: pulse test. ? classification of h fe1 rank b c d range 60-120 100-200 160-320
